Chapter 44 The Pillar of Light Connecting to the Sky, the Power of God

Rumbling--
A muffled sound came from underground, and the green grass formed waves that spread outwards into the distance. The area that spread was so large that it covered the entire Wales and a small part of England in just a few seconds, and it was only a few dozen kilometers away from London, the capital of England.
A strong tremor followed, prompting earthquake monitoring agencies throughout Britain to issue piercing red alerts.
Earthquake monitoring personnel reported the incident with alarm to higher authorities in various cities and regions.
Earthquakes always occur in waves. The first shock wave is not the strongest, but the peak value of the earthquake can be estimated based on the intensity of the first shock wave.
At the Cardiff earthquake monitoring station, piercing alarms blared incessantly, and red monitoring lights flashed continuously.
Wuwu~wuwu~
"Oh my god! An earthquake! The initial shockwave reached 6.0, how is that possible!" the monitoring staff screamed, frantically calling the Cardiff Parliament office.
The largest earthquake to have occurred in Britain in the last century was only 6.1 on the Richter Reef, and that was in the Gulf. Britain is not located on a seismic belt and is a region where earthquakes are rare.
Therefore, in Britain, only the capital cities of each region have earthquake monitoring stations.
The Cardiff MP slammed his fist on the table and shouted, "What did you say? An earthquake? Maybe a major earthquake of magnitude 8.0 or higher? Nonsense! Britain isn't even on an earthquake belt, how could there be an earthquake of that magnitude?"
"Do you know how much money it would cost to organize a refuge for all citizens of Cardiff? At most, I can issue a notice on behalf of Parliament."
“Let the citizens of Cardiff bear the losses themselves. Parliament has no obligation to pay for the losses of its citizens. Even if there is a major earthquake, it is not Parliament’s fault. It is a natural disaster, and Parliament is also a victim.”
The same thing is happening in local councils across the country. From the perspective of the country's leadership, the councils have no obligation to organize people to evacuate or to pay for disaster relief. Natural disasters are none of the councils' business, and the people should deal with them on their own.
Cardiff Police Station.
"You all felt the tremors, didn't you? The council has announced that a major earthquake is coming soon. Your duty is to protect the assets of our major taxpayers," the heavily pregnant police chief said to all the superintendents and inspectors in the police station.
"To prevent violent robberies, rubber bullets should be replaced with live ammunition."
A young police superintendent stood up and asked, "Chief, what about ordinary citizens? And what about the emergency supplies prepared for civilians during evacuation?"
"Shouldn't we allocate some police resources to maintain public order?"
Another middle-aged police superintendent spoke up: "Superintendent Irwin, all we need for civilians are community police. We should serve whoever pays taxes to the council. Please take note."
Superintendent Owen clenched his fist: "But..."
"No buts. Alright, sit down, Superintendent Owen. Don't say anything from now on," the chief said impatiently. This Owen really didn't know what was good for him, always doing things that were detrimental to the police department, forcing the entire department to pay some expenses on civilians.
He still doesn't understand that wasting police resources on civilians is a waste of public funds. Everyone in the police department dislikes him. Doesn't he know that?
He had always wanted to kick Irving out of office, but every time he was elected by the civilians, his approval rating was higher than all the superintendents combined.
If the police chief hadn't been directly elected by the council, he probably would still be in that position.
Irving silently gritted his teeth, his neck flushed with anger as he sat down, his hands clasped together under the table.
His fellow superintendents around him looked at him with mockery. They laughed, wondering what benefit it would bring him to stand with civilians and seek benefits for them. Not only was he ostracized, but he was also looked down upon by members of parliament.
If you want to climb the ranks and be assigned to a lucrative law enforcement district, you need to cultivate good relationships with legislators and big businessmen.
Irving ignored his colleagues' mockery and remained steadfast in his determination to do what he wanted to do.
He knew that his colleagues were not on his side; they were two different kinds of people.
He had thoroughly studied Marxism-Leninism and knew what kind of country this was, so he firmly stood on the side of the people. 'These vermin! They know a major earthquake is coming and instead of organizing the people to evacuate, they're only thinking about protecting the property of the powerful and currying favor with them.' Irving gritted his teeth.
He used to be confused, but after visiting Xia Guo, he realized that this was the right thing for the police to do.
After returning home, he worked hard to help ordinary people resolve their cases and fight for their rights in various communities in Cardiff, gaining their support.
He rose through the ranks from community police officer to superintendent, but his power was minimal; he had virtually no say in the police station and was essentially a figurehead.
Air raid sirens sounded throughout Cardiff.
People who received the earthquake warning panicked and ran out of their homes to escape to open spaces. Along the way, some malicious people would naturally engage in acts of vandalism and looting.
The whole of Cardiff is in chaos.
Looking down from above, large crowds were running out of the buildings, screams and shouts filled the air. Some ran towards the suburbs, others towards the square. The honking of car horns was deafening, and some roads were blocked by cars.
Police officers, armed with guns, protected the wealthy area, preventing civilians from sneaking in. They would whistle and fire warning shots if anyone approached.
Rumble…
The ground shook violently, and the houses began to sway violently, as if they were about to disintegrate and collapse at any moment.
"Ahhh! An earthquake has struck!"
"Run!"
The people taking refuge screamed in terror, and those behind kept shoving those in front; human fear was vividly portrayed in this moment.
Just then, a bright beam of light rose from the direction of Scotland, shooting straight into the sky.
The beam of light was enormous, illuminating the entire sky. A cloud was directly above the beam of light, and it was immediately dispersed.
The beam of light illuminated the entire city of Cardiff, bathing the rooftops of houses in a glow. The fleeing refugees looked up in awe at this incredible sight.
This stunning scene can be seen not only in Cardiff, but throughout Wales.
Even as far away as London, England, one could see the rising sun on the horizon, and in that light, the distant horizon seemed still in daylight.
"Oh my god! What is that?"
"What happened over there?! It's unbelievable!"
Was that God descending upon us?
Anyone who witnessed this scene looked up in awe, as if they felt nothing but shock.
Even the members of those national parliaments stared in disbelief at the distant horizon that had turned into daylight.
In a corner of London, Joan of Arc looked up at the distant horizon in the daylight, behind her the skeleton of a Devourer and the black, viscous liquid that covered the ground.
"Master's power... God's power, is Master sealing away that lost object that could destroy a country?"
